Question - Tesco Case Study -Assume that on February 20 (The last day of Tesco's half year reporting period ending on 21 February) Tesco received £200 million in prepayments from Unilever under the expectation that Tesco will purchase a certain volume of products over the next three years. Further, assume that during the following six months Tesco purchased £450 million in products from Unilever, out of which it sold 50% of the inventory for £250 million. It also earned £50 million of the deferred income as a result of the above purchase. How would Tesco account for these transactions for its fiscal report ending on February 21 and on August 23, 2014.
